Ipod touch 2nd generation wont turn on or show up on itunes or charge help!
my ipod touch 2nd generation version 3.1.3. all o0f a sudden had stopped charging and will no longer show up in itunes.when i tried charging it that day it wouldnt charge and now its dead. i tried charging it back up and wont charge and when i try to turn it on it only shows the apple with black background and turns off again.any suggestions please text (574) 344-6625 or email [email protected] or [email protected]
Not Charge
- See:
iPod touch: Hardware troubleshooting
- Try another cable. Some 5G iPods were shipped with Lightning cable that were either initially defective or failed after short use.
- Try another charging source
- Inspect the dock connector on the iPod for bent or missing contacts, foreign material, corroded contacts, broken, missing or cracked plastic.
- Make an appointment at the Genius Bar of an Apple store.
Apple Retail Store - Genius Bar
Also:
Try:
- iOS: Not responding or does not turn on
- Also try DFU mode after try recovery mode
How to put iPod touch / iPhone into DFU mode « Karthik's scribblings
- If not successful and you can't fully turn the iOS device fully off, let the battery fully drain. After charging for an least an hour try the above again.
- Try on another computer
- If still not successful that usually indicates a hardware problem and an appointment at the Genius Bar of an Apple store is in order.
